Output 0a9943c5d8f65e4ec69336a3e2aa70601742978bdbfff9dcc42f5fb85b288ec8:17

value
3005069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ef767102bc076b2d0c5b060195bf37b886310c8e OP_EQUAL
address
3PXBJr6aLgL3aUJhzoSZ8B2kqCRBpJpYQi
transaction
0a9943c5d8f65e4ec69336a3e2aa70601742978bdbfff9dcc42f5fb85b288ec8
confirmations
284444
spent
true